Artist Statement

Gardening is a quiet but important art form. It shapes the look, feel and atmosphere of our streets, our childhoods, our lives. Gardens are the products of determined visions: of sweat, of patience, of entwined cultural influences. 

The Village is a photography and oral history installation. Recorded reminiscences offer glimpses into the creative processes and social history behind both some remarkable older gardens of Reservoir, and the suburb itself. Contemporary photographs present a view of suburban gardens informed by these memories and the artist’s own imaginings of past times.

Listen to Mrs Simmons of Charlton Crescent, to Vincenza and her son Albert of Wilson Boulevard or to Enrico of Hughes Parade, and survey their gardens and neighbourhoods for traces of the suburb they remember, the Reservoir of the 1960s and 70s – The Village.
